03/06/2026 (Agence Europe) – Belgium and Bulgaria will benefit in 2026 from an increase in their quota of euro coins put into circulation, following a favourable decision by the European Central Bank (ECB) published on Wednesday 3 June in the Official Journal of the European Union. The ECB approved last May a substantial increase in the volume of coins intended for circulation in Bulgaria in order to meet strong demand linked to the recent adoption of the euro and the continued exchange of levs for euros. Belgium, for its part, has obtained an increase in its quota of collector coins to allow the issuance of two new gold investment coins (the ‘Belga Gold’) with face values of €75 and €300.
